A semiempirical model of the bubble growth or its dissolution in glass melts containing a fining agent has been derived. The model applies the experimental data from bubble observation at melting and fining temperatures – temperature dependences of the average growth rate of the bubble radius and the average concentration of the fining gas in bubbles.
